Community and Charity Work Additionally, Tony and Marti contribute a portion of each and every home sale commission to the Coldwell Banker CARES Foundation, a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ization designed to direct the philanthropic and volunteer activities of Coldwell Banker Residential Brokerage to improve the quality of life in the communities their sales associates and employees serve. The Coldwell Banker Residential Brokerage
CARES Foundation is unique in that Coldwell Banker sales associates and employees are the primary funders of the Foundation. Each can select a specific pledge amount to be deducted from their commission or payroll check, and the company matches dollar-for-dollar the pledged contributions. In just the first two years of existence, the Foundation has already made a significant impact in the Atlanta community; raising nearly $370,000 and making contributions ranging from $250 to $20,000 to 116 different organizations in metro Atlanta. In addition, the Foundation sponsored a home with Atlanta Habitat for Humanity in 2006 — including the $75,000 sponsorship fee plus more than 2,240 volunteer hours by sales associates and staff to build the home.
